Can't trade recently drafted players after the World Series

Not sure if this is a bug or just an oversight, but when I try and trade for recently drafted players after the World Series, it's telling me I can't trade for them.

The rule use to be you couldn't trade a player less than a full year from being drafted, but after the Trea Turner trade ordeal, the MLB changed the rule in 2015 that allowed them to trade players after the World Series in the same year they were drafted. You can't do this in the game, though.

No, I know that. The issue is, they changed the rule IRL in 2015 to allow teams to trade recently drafted players after the World Series.

So basically per the new rules, a player is drafted in June and after the World Series in October, you can now trade them. Which is 4-5 months after being drafted.

In the game, though, a player is drafted in June and he can't be traded until June of the following year (per the old rules). You still have to wait a full year.

I'm fine w/ the "can't trade recently drafted players" part... but it should reflect the new rule that states you can trade them starting in the offseason instead of having to wait a full year per the old rule.
